Sha256: 506232db1d2e84e7fd7dcea0af432d48a147bc0bf9a2d8a7b2d30a3a7729e177

Contents?: true

Size: 1.31 KB

Versions: 39

Compression:

Stored size: 1.31 KB

Contents

tinymce.PluginManager.add("advlist",function(a){function b(a,b){var c=[];return tinymce.each(b.split(/[ ,]/),function(a){c.push({text:a.replace(/\-/g," ").replace(/\b\w/g,function(a){return a.toUpperCase()}),data:"default"==a?"":a})}),c}function c(b,c){a.undoManager.transact(function(){var d,e=a.dom,f=a.selection;if(d=e.getParent(f.getNode(),"ol,ul"),!d||d.nodeName!=b||c===!1){var h={"list-style-type":c?c:""};a.execCommand("UL"==b?"InsertUnorderedList":"InsertOrderedList",!1,h)}c=c===!1?g[b]:c,g[b]=c,d=e.getParent(f.getNode(),"ol,ul"),d&&(e.setStyle(d,"listStyleType",c?c:null),d.removeAttribute("data-mce-style")),a.focus()})}function d(b){var c=a.dom.getStyle(a.dom.getParent(a.selection.getNode(),"ol,ul"),"listStyleType")||"";b.control.items().each(function(a){a.active(a.settings.data===c)})}var e,f,g={};e=b("OL",a.getParam("advlist_number_styles","default,lower-alpha,lower-greek,lower-roman,upper-alpha,upper-roman")),f=b("UL",a.getParam("advlist_bullet_styles","default,circle,disc,square")),a.addButton("numlist",{type:"splitbutton",tooltip:"Numbered list",menu:e,onshow:d,onselect:function(a){c("OL",a.control.settings.data)},onclick:function(){c("OL",!1)}}),a.addButton("bullist",{type:"splitbutton",tooltip:"Bullet list",menu:f,onshow:d,onselect:function(a){c("UL",a.control.settings.data)},onclick:function(){c("UL",!1)}})});

Version data entries

39 entries across 39 versions & 1 rubygems

Version Path
wbase-0.3.20 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.19 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.18 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.17 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.16 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.15 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.14 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.13 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.12 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.11 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.10 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.9 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.8 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.7 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.6 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.5 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.4 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.3 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.2 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js
wbase-0.3.1 lib/vendor/admin/tinymce/plugins/advlist/plugin.min.js